What This Scan Is Actually Showing You
An ultrasound of the abdomen and pelvis uses sound waves to build real-time images of the organs sitting in these regions: liver, gallbladder, pancreas, kidneys, spleen, bladder, and for women, the uterus and ovaries too.
Sound Wave Technology & Safety
- Since it runs on sound waves instead of radiation, it's considered extremely safe,
- which is a big part of why it's used across such a wide range of ages and conditions without hesitation.
Organ Structural Assessment
- The images end up showing the size, shape, and texture of these organs,
- along with any abnormal growths, fluid collections, stones, or structural quirks that might be sitting quietly underneath.
It's a genuinely thorough look at a huge chunk of your internal anatomy, all in a single sitting.
Why This Scan Gets Ordered So Often
Abdominal and pelvic discomfort can come from an almost endless list of causes, and a USG Abdomen & Pelvis Scan in Shivaji Nagar is often the fastest route to actually narrowing things down. Persistent stomach pain, bloating that won’t settle, unexplained weight changes, urinary symptoms, or menstrual irregularities can all point toward very different problems, and an ultrasound gives doctors a direct visual instead of relying purely on physical exams and symptom tracking.
Common Diagnostic Indications
It’s especially good at picking up gallstones, kidney stones, cysts, fibroids, an enlarged liver or spleen, and fluid buildup in the abdomen, things that wouldn’t necessarily show up in blood tests alone.
More often than people expect,
this scan ends up being the piece that either confirms a suspected diagnosis
or redirects the whole investigation.

Common Reasons This Gets Recommended
Doctors order this scan for a genuinely wide range of reasons: persistent abdominal pain, unexplained bloating, suspected gallstones or kidney stones, urinary symptoms, and monitoring liver conditions among the most common. For women, it’s frequently used to investigate irregular periods, pelvic pain, suspected fibroids or cysts, and as part of routine early pregnancy monitoring.
It’s also often part of a broader health checkup, particularly for people with a family history of liver, kidney, or reproductive health issues, since catching something early here can genuinely change how it’s managed down the line.

What the Scan Process Actually Feels Like
There’s genuinely nothing intimidating here. You’ll lie down comfortably while a gel is applied to your abdomen, and a small handheld device gets moved gently over the area, capturing images in real time on a screen. No needles, no discomfort, and zero radiation exposure.
Pelvic scans usually need a full bladder instead, which helps push the intestines out of the way for a clearer view. We’ll walk you through exactly what applies to your specific scan when you book.
